Understanding Mobile Aerial Platforms

Mobile aerial platforms refer to a range of equipment including scissor lifts, boom lifts, and all-terrain lifts that enable operators to achieve high-altitude access. These platforms are increasingly being used in various industries such as construction, utilities, and forestry, particularly in rugged or uneven terrains where traditional machinery might struggle.

The Importance of Terrain Adaptability

One of the primary benefits of mobile aerial platforms on rough terrain is their adaptability. These machines are engineered with advanced suspension systems and can navigate across challenging landscapes such as slopes, muddy areas, or rocky surfaces. This capability allows workers to reach elevated positions safely and efficiently, reducing the need for extensive scaffolding or other labor-intensive methods.

Safety Features for Enhanced Operations

Safety is paramount in any construction or industrial setting. Mobile aerial platforms on rough terrain are designed with various safety features, including stabilizers, guardrails, and advanced controls, ensuring that operators can work with confidence.
